Comprehending Disability Scooters
Disability scooters are electric mobility scooters uk lorries created to assist individuals with mobility disabilities. These scooters can be found in numerous sizes and shapes, making it much easier for users to browse through indoor and outdoor environments.
Types of Disability Scooters
When thinking about a disability scooter, it is necessary to understand the numerous types offered in the market:
TypeDescriptionAdvantages3-Wheel ScootersIdeal for indoor usage due to their tight turning radius.Easier to navigate in small areas.4-Wheel ScootersSupply much better stability, security, and enhanced outside efficiency.Ideal for irregular surfaces and longer distances.Sturdy ScootersCreated for bigger people, these scooters can manage more weight and deal enhanced toughness.Increased weight capability and robust features.Folding ScootersCompact and quickly collapsible, making them best for travel.Portable, lightweight, and simple to store.All-Terrain ScootersEquipped for a range of surface areas, from rough terrain to pavement.Suitable for outdoor activity and experience.Benefits of Using Disability Scooters
Disability scooters provide numerous benefits that contribute favorably to people' lives. These consist of:
Enhanced Mobility: Users can take a trip longer distances without physical pressure, permitting higher flexibility and mobility.Independence: Scooters allow people to keep their independence in everyday activities, such as shopping, going to occasions, or checking out buddies.Improved Safety: Many scooters featured features like lights, indications, and anti-tip mechanisms that boost user safety.Convenience: Many models offer cushioned seats, adjustable armrests, and easy to use controls, making them comfy for extended use.Versatility: Mobility scooters can be used inside your home and outdoors, making them a useful choice for various environments.Finding Disability Scooters Nearby

Choosing the ideal mobility scooter includes numerous factors to consider:
Weight Capacity: Ensure the scooter can safely support the user's weight.Variety: Consider how far the scooter can travel on a complete charge, dealing with the user's needs.Seat Comfort: Look for an ergonomic seat that supplies correct assistance, particularly for longer journeys.Mobility: If taking a trip regularly, consider a folding scooter for ease of transport.Terrain: Choose a scooter developed for the kind of environment you'll be using it in-- whether it's smooth walkways or rugged surfaces.Often Asked Questions (FAQs)1. Just how much do disability scooters cost?
The price of disability scooters differs substantially based upon features, type, and brand name. Typically, rates can range from ₤ 800 to over ₤ 3,000.
2. Do I require a prescription to buy a mobility scooter [marvelvsdc.Faith]?
A prescription is not generally required for buying a mobility scooter, but it may be needed for insurance coverage.
3. Can I use a disability scooter without a motorist's license?
Yes, individuals can operate mobility scooters without a chauffeur's license, as they are not classified as automobile.
4. How quickly can disability scooters go?
Most mobility scooters have a speed series of 4 to 8 miles per hour, depending on the model.
5. Can I take my scooter on public transport?
Numerous public transportation services accommodate mobility scooters, but contacting the particular transport authority for policies and availability is advisable.
